To be eligible for the BSc degree program at Om Shri Vishvakarma ji Mahavidyalaya in Kanpur, candidates must have completed their 10+2 education from a recognized board with a minimum aggregate of 50%. Additionally, applicants must have studied Physics, Chemistry, and Mathematics as compulsory subjects in their qualifying examination. Admissions are granted based on merit, as determined by the college's selection committee. It is also important for students to meet any additional requirements set by the college, such as entrance exams or interviews.
